Meaning
Spinal cord trauma management involves a multidisciplinary approach to care for individuals who have experienced spinal cord injuries. It encompasses various medical interventions, surgical procedures, rehabilitation therapies, assistive devices, and supportive care aimed at minimizing the impact of spinal cord damage and optimizing patient outcomes. The primary goals of spinal cord trauma management are to prevent further damage, stabilize the spine, promote neurological recovery, manage complications, and enhance the overall well-being of patients.

Category-wise Insights
- Surgical interventions: Surgical interventions play a crucial role in spinal cord trauma management, especially in cases of traumatic fractures and decompression of the spinal cord. Surgical procedures may involve stabilization, fusion, and decompression techniques to relieve pressure on the spinal cord and optimize neurological recovery.
- Medical devices: Medical devices such as spinal implants, neurostimulation devices, and external support systems play a vital role in spinal cord trauma management. These devices provide structural support, restore mobility, and enhance functional outcomes for individuals with spinal cord injuries.
- Pharmacological interventions: Pharmacological interventions, including analgesics, anti-inflammatory drugs, and neuroprotective agents, may be used to manage pain, reduce inflammation, and prevent secondary damage to the spinal cord.
- Rehabilitation therapies: Rehabilitation therapies, including physical therapy, occupational therapy, and assistive technologies, are essential components of spinal cord trauma management. These therapies aim to improve mobility, strength, coordination, and independence in daily activities.
- Supportive care: Supportive care focuses on providing comprehensive care for individuals with spinal cord injuries, addressing their physical, emotional, and psychological needs. It involves specialized nursing care, psychological counseling, and assistive devices to enhance the quality of life and overall well-being of patients.
